Ohio Republican Senate candidate Jane Timken on Tuesday received three Senate endorsements that followed retiring Sen. Rob Portman (R-Ohio) picking her as his desired successor last week.
Sens. Joni Ernst (R-Iowa), Shelley Moore Capito (R-W.Va.) and Deb Fischer (R-Neb.) all backed Timken, citing what they said were her conservative credentials in a statement first seen by The Hill.
“As a fellow Midwesterner, Jane understands the challenges our farmers and small businesses face, and I look forward to working alongside another powerful mom and female in the U.S. Senate," Ernst said.

“Timken” always reminds me of the Timken roller bearings, which revolutionized railroading. Prior to them in on the car wheel axles were sleeve bearings which had to be oiled all the time and could get hot (”hot boxes”). Also, the sleeve bearings need extra pull to get them rolling. With the Timken bearings trains could be longer because that friction was no longer present.

Various figures from Trump World have fanned out across the state’s Senate campaigns. Kellyanne Conway, a longtime adviser to Trump, announced this week that she was endorsing Timken and joining her campaign as a senior strategist. In her endorsement, Conway referred to Timken as a “true MAGA champion,” using the acronym for “make America great again,” one of Trump’s main political slogans.
